Description

What is the biggest challenge in recruitment of good technical staff? What is being taught in schools and colleges and how is it delivered? Who decides what should be taught? How could things be done better? I don’t pretend to know all the answers, but I am an educator and I know how students learn and can show how technical education and relevant skills are being delivered and where the gaps are. GCSE ICT is gone, replaced by computer science. Sixth form colleges are switching to ‘T-levels’ and A-level computer science is already replacing ICT.
